What Is a Strong Sense of Self Identity?
A strong sense of self identity refers to a well-developed and confident understanding of one's personal characteristics, values, beliefs, and life direction.
People with a strong self identity typically know:
What they value most
What they believe in
What their strengths and weaknesses are
What goals they want to achieve
What kind of person they want to become
This clarity creates consistency between thoughts, decisions, and actions.
A strong self identity does not mean never changing. Instead, it means maintaining a stable understanding of oneself while continuing to learn and grow.

Characteristics of a Strong Self Identity
Several qualities are commonly associated with a strong sense of self identity.
Self Awareness
Individuals understand their emotions, motivations, strengths, and weaknesses.
Clear Values
They know what principles guide their decisions and behavior.
Confidence
They trust themselves and their ability to make decisions.
Authenticity
They act in ways that align with their beliefs and values.
Purpose
They have a sense of direction and meaning in life.
Consistency
Their actions generally reflect their personal beliefs and goals.
Together, these characteristics create a stable and authentic sense of self.

Confidence and Self Identity
Confidence often develops from knowing and accepting oneself.
A strong self identity allows individuals to trust their judgment rather than relying excessively on external approval. They are comfortable with who they are while remaining open to growth and improvement.
Confidence supported by self-understanding is generally more stable than confidence based solely on achievements or recognition.

Can a Strong Self Identity Prevent Identity Confusion?
A strong self identity can reduce identity confusion, although it does not eliminate life's challenges.
People with a clear sense of self are generally better equipped to handle change because they have a stable foundation of values and self-understanding.
Even when circumstances change, they can adapt without completely losing their sense of who they are.
How Personal Growth Strengthens Self Identity
Identity and growth support one another.
As individuals learn, reflect, and gain new experiences, they develop a deeper understanding of themselves. Personal growth often strengthens identity by increasing self-awareness, confidence, and resilience.
Growth allows identity to become more refined without losing authenticity.
This balance between stability and development is a hallmark of a strong self identity.
